How to fix uneven cooling in different areas of my home using the Lennox 13ACX Air Conditioner?
Fixing uneven cooling in different areas of your home using the Lennox 13ACX Air Conditioner requires a combination of strategies that address both the air conditioning system itself and factors related to your home's design and insulation. Here are steps you can take to achieve more balanced and consistent cooling:
1. Check and Replace Air Filters:
Dirty or clogged air filters can restrict airflow, leading to uneven cooling. Make sure your air filters are clean and replace them regularly, typically every one to three months. If you have pets or allergies, you may need to change them more frequently.
2. Adjust the Thermostat Settings:
Ensure that your thermostat is set to the desired temperature and that it's functioning correctly. Consider using a programmable or smart thermostat to maintain a consistent temperature throughout the day and night.
3. Inspect and Seal Ductwork:
Leaky or poorly insulated ductwork can result in cooled air escaping before it reaches certain areas of your home. Have a professional HVAC technician inspect your ducts for leaks and insulation issues. Sealing and insulating ducts can significantly improve airflow and cooling efficiency.
4. Balance the Airflow:
If you have a forced-air HVAC system, make sure that the airflow is balanced by adjusting the dampers or registers in each room. This can help redirect more conditioned air to areas that are typically warmer.
5. Clean the Outdoor Unit:
Keep the outdoor unit (condenser) clean and free from debris, as airflow problems can affect the efficiency of the system. Regularly remove leaves, dirt, and obstructions around the unit.
6. Consider Zoning Systems:
Zoning systems allow you to divide your home into separate cooling zones, each with its thermostat. This allows for precise temperature control in different areas. A professional HVAC technician can install a zoning system tailored to your home's layout and needs.
7. Inspect and Upgrade Insulation:
Inadequate insulation in walls, ceilings, and attics can contribute to uneven cooling. Ensure that your home is well-insulated to maintain consistent temperatures throughout.
8. Install Ceiling Fans:
Ceiling fans can help distribute cool air more evenly throughout a room. Make sure they are set to rotate counterclockwise during the summer months to create a cooling breeze.
9. Block Direct Sunlight:
Sunlight streaming through windows can heat up a room quickly. Use blinds, curtains, or shades to block direct sunlight during the hottest parts of the day.
10. Minimize Heat-Producing Appliances:
Appliances like ovens, stoves, and dryers generate heat. Try to use them during cooler parts of the day or consider more energy-efficient appliances to reduce the heat load on your home.
11. Seal Leaks and Gaps:
Inspect doors and windows for gaps and leaks that could allow warm outdoor air to enter your home. Proper sealing can help maintain a consistent indoor temperature.
12. Consider Window Film or Insulation:
Window films or insulated window coverings can help reduce heat gain from sunlight and improve energy efficiency.
13. Professional HVAC Inspection:
If you continue to experience uneven cooling despite taking these measures, consider scheduling a professional HVAC inspection. There may be issues with your Lennox 13ACX Air Conditioner, such as a refrigerant problem or compressor issue, that require expert diagnosis and repair.
14. Install a Ductless Mini-Split System:
In cases where certain areas of your home consistently struggle with cooling, consider installing ductless mini-split systems. These systems provide individual cooling units for specific rooms or zones, allowing you to address hot spots directly.
15. Regular Maintenance:
To ensure your Lennox 13ACX Air Conditioner operates efficiently and maintains consistent cooling, schedule regular professional maintenance. An HVAC technician can perform tune-ups, clean the system, and address any issues that could impact performance.
Addressing uneven cooling in your home using the Lennox 13ACX Air Conditioner involves a combination of maintenance, adjustments, and potentially some home improvements. It's essential to evaluate your specific situation and consider the recommendations of HVAC professionals to achieve the most effective and comfortable cooling solution for your home.
